The Arm of the Carabineers, been based on 1814, is a body of the Italian Army. Depute primarily to the military actions and to the security piblic, the Carabineers have a widespread presence on all territory where they develop tasks whether to direct service of citizens, or in the struggle to the crime and in the protection of the artistic property. The number to contact in case of emergency is 112; here you will find the deliveries and the addresses of the "stations" and of the barracks.

Jeune fille rousse (Jeanne Hébuterne), 1918 Modigliani and the Montparnasse Adventure
On 22 January 1920 Amedeo Modigliani was taken, unconscious, to the Hôpital de la Charité in Paris and died there two days later at the age of only 36, struck down by the then incurable disease of tubercular meningitis that he had miraculously managed to survive twenty years earlier.
